Chuyển đổi PPTM sang PDF
Giới thiệu
Trong lĩnh vực quản lý và chuyển đổi tài liệu, hiệu quả là điều tối quan trọng. Cho dù bạn đang xử lý tệp PowerPoint hay tệp PDF, khả năng chuyển đổi liền mạch giữa các định dạng có thể hợp lý hóa quy trình làm việc và nâng cao năng suất. GroupDocs.Conversion for .NET nổi bật như một công cụ mạnh mẽ trong lĩnh vực này, cung cấp cho các nhà phát triển giải pháp toàn diện để chuyển đổi các tệp PPTM (Bản trình bày hỗ trợ macro PowerPoint) sang định dạng PDF một cách dễ dàng.
Điều kiện tiên quyết
Trước khi đi sâu vào quá trình chuyển đổi, hãy đảm bảo bạn có sẵn các điều kiện tiên quyết sau:
1. Cài đặt GroupDocs.Conversion cho .NET
Đầu tiên và quan trọng nhất, hãy tải xuống và cài đặt thư viện GroupDocs.Conversion cho .NET. Bạn có thể truy cập liên kết tải xuốngđây. Làm theo hướng dẫn cài đặt được cung cấp để tích hợp thư viện vào dự án .NET của bạn một cách liền mạch.
2. Lấy tệp PPTM mẫu
Để kiểm tra quá trình chuyển đổi, hãy lấy tệp PPTM mẫu. Bạn có thể sử dụng tệp PPTM của riêng mình hoặc tải xuống tệp cho mục đích thử nghiệm.
3. Thiết lập môi trường phát triển
Đảm bảo rằng bạn đã thiết lập môi trường phát triển cho lập trình .NET, bao gồm IDE (Môi trường phát triển tích hợp) phù hợp, chẳng hạn như Visual Studio.
4. Hiểu biết cơ bản về lập trình C#
Làm quen với những điều cơ bản về ngôn ngữ lập trình C# vì các ví dụ mã được cung cấp được viết bằng C#.
Nhập không gian tên
Trước khi đi sâu vào quá trình chuyển đổi, hãy nhập các vùng tên cần thiết để truy cập liền mạch các chức năng của GroupDocs.Conversion cho .NET.
using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;
Bây giờ, hãy chia nhỏ quy trình chuyển đổi tệp PPTM sang định dạng PDF bằng GroupDocs.Conversion for .NET thành hướng dẫn từng bước:
Bước 1: Xác định đường dẫn thư mục và tệp đầu ra
Xác định thư mục đầu ra nơi tệp PDF đã chuyển đổi sẽ được lưu và chỉ định tên tệp đầu ra.
string outputFolder = "Your Document Directory";
string outputFile = Path.Combine(outputFolder, "pptm-converted-to.pdf");
Bước 2: Tải tệp PPTM nguồn
Tải tệp PPTM nguồn mà bạn định chuyển đổi sang PDF bằng GroupDocs.Conversion for .NET.
using (var converter = new GroupDocs.Conversion.Converter(Constants.SAMPLE_PPTM))
Bước 3: Định cấu hình tùy chọn chuyển đổi
Định cấu hình các tùy chọn chuyển đổi theo yêu cầu của bạn. Trong trường hợp này, chúng tôi đang chuyển đổi sang định dạng PDF, vì vậy hãy tạo một phiên bản củaPdfConvertOptions
.
{
var options = new PdfConvertOptions();
Bước 4: Thực hiện chuyển đổi
Bắt đầu quá trình chuyển đổi bằng cách gọiConvert
phương thức của phiên bản trình chuyển đổi và chuyển đường dẫn tệp đầu ra cũng như các tùy chọn chuyển đổi.
converter.Convert(outputFile, options);
Bước 5: Xác minh hoàn tất chuyển đổi
Sau khi quá trình chuyển đổi hoàn tất, hãy hiển thị thông báo cho biết quá trình chuyển đổi thành công cùng với đường dẫn lưu tệp PDF đã chuyển đổi.
Console.WriteLine("\nConversion to pdf completed successfully. \nCheck output in {0}", outputFolder);
Phần kết luận
Tóm lại, GroupDocs.Conversion for .NET cung cấp cho các nhà phát triển một giải pháp mạnh mẽ và hiệu quả để chuyển đổi các tệp PPTM sang định dạng PDF một cách dễ dàng. Bằng cách làm theo hướng dẫn từng bước được nêu ở trên, bạn có thể tích hợp liền mạch chức năng này vào các ứng dụng .NET của mình, từ đó nâng cao năng suất và hợp lý hóa quy trình quản lý tài liệu.
Câu hỏi thường gặp
GroupDocs.Conversion cho .NET có tương thích với tất cả các phiên bản .NET không?
Có, GroupDocs.Conversion for .NET tương thích với tất cả các phiên bản .NET, đảm bảo khả năng tương thích rộng rãi cho các nhà phát triển.
Tôi có thể chuyển đổi đồng thời nhiều tệp PPTM bằng GroupDocs.Conversion cho .NET không?
Hoàn toàn có thể, GroupDocs.Conversion for .NET hỗ trợ chuyển đổi hàng loạt, cho phép bạn chuyển đổi nhiều tệp PPTM trong một lần.
GroupDocs.Conversion cho .NET có yêu cầu giấy phép sử dụng thương mại không?
Có, cần có giấy phép để sử dụng thương mại. Bạn có thể lấy giấy phép tạm thời cho mục đích thử nghiệm hoặc mua giấy phép đầy đủ để triển khai thương mại.
Có bất kỳ hạn chế nào về kích thước của tệp PPTM có thể được chuyển đổi bằng GroupDocs.Conversion cho .NET không?
GroupDocs.Conversion dành cho .NET được thiết kế để xử lý các tệp lớn một cách hiệu quả nhưng bạn nên thử nghiệm với kích thước tệp cụ thể của mình để có hiệu suất tối ưu.
GroupDocs.Conversion cho .NET có hỗ trợ chuyển đổi sang các định dạng khác ngoài PDF không?
Có, GroupDocs.Conversion for .NET hỗ trợ chuyển đổi sang nhiều định dạng, bao gồm DOCX, XLSX, HTML, v.v.